1. Define Your Requirements and Objectives
Before diving into the evaluation process, it’s essential to clearly define your organization’s requirements and objectives for the software solution. Start by identifying the key business processes or workflows that the software needs to support. Gather input from stakeholders across different departments to understand their specific needs and pain points.
Next, prioritize your requirements based on their criticality and impact on your operations. Separate them into must-have features, nice-to-have features, and features that can be addressed through customization or integration with other systems. This exercise will help you focus your evaluation efforts on the most important aspects of the software.

2. Understand the Core Functionalities
Once you have a clear understanding of your requirements, delve into the core functionalities offered by the software products under consideration. These functionalities form the foundation of the software and are essential for meeting your organization’s primary needs. Some common core functionalities to evaluate include:
- Data Management and Reporting: Assess the software’s ability to capture, store, and analyze data efficiently. Evaluate the reporting capabilities, dashboards, and data visualization tools.
- Workflow Automation: Examine the software’s workflow automation features, including task assignment, approval processes, and notifications.
- Integration Capabilities: Evaluate the software’s ability to integrate with existing systems and applications within your organization, ensuring seamless data exchange and interoperability.
- User Access and Permissions: Assess the software’s user management capabilities, including role-based access controls, user authentication, and audit trails.
- Scalability and Performance: Evaluate the software’s ability to handle increasing workloads and data volumes, ensuring it can grow with your organization’s needs.
3. Assess Advanced Features and Specialized Capabilities
In addition to core functionalities, many software products offer advanced features and specialized capabilities tailored to specific industries or use cases. As a procurement official, you should evaluate these features to determine if they can provide added value or competitive advantages for your organization. Some examples include:
- Supplier Management: Assess the software’s capabilities for managing supplier relationships, including vendor onboarding, performance evaluation, and contract management.
- Spend Analysis: Evaluate the software’s ability to analyze spend data, identify cost-saving opportunities, and optimize procurement processes.
- Sourcing and Bidding: Examine the software’s features for conducting sourcing events, managing RFPs, and facilitating bidding processes.
- Inventory Management: Assess the software’s capabilities for managing inventory levels, tracking stock movements, and generating replenishment orders.
- Analytics and Reporting: Evaluate the software’s advanced analytics and reporting features, such as predictive analytics, scenario modeling, and customizable dashboards.
4. Consider User Experience and Usability
While functionality is paramount, user experience and usability should also be key considerations when evaluating software products. A user-friendly interface and intuitive navigation can significantly impact user adoption, productivity, and overall satisfaction. Assess the following aspects:
- User Interface (UI) Design: Evaluate the software’s UI design, including layout, color schemes, and visual appeal.
- Navigation and Workflows: Assess the software’s navigation structure and ensure it aligns with your organization’s workflows and processes.
- Mobile Accessibility: If mobile access is a requirement, evaluate the software’s mobile compatibility and responsiveness across different devices.
- Learning Curve and Training Resources: Consider the software’s learning curve and the availability of training resources, such as documentation, tutorials, and support services.
5. Evaluate Vendor Support and Services
The quality of vendor support and services can significantly impact the long-term success and ROI of your software investment. Evaluate the following aspects related to vendor support:
- Technical Support: Assess the vendor’s technical support offerings, including response times, support channels (e.g., phone, email, chat), and the expertise of their support staff.
- Training and Onboarding: Evaluate the vendor’s training programs, including on-site training, online resources, and customized training options.
- Upgrades and Maintenance: Understand the vendor’s approach to software upgrades, patches, and maintenance, ensuring timely updates and security fixes.
- Implementation Services: If required, assess the vendor’s implementation services, including project management, data migration, and customization support.
- Community and Knowledge Base: Evaluate the vendor’s online community forums, knowledge base, and self-service resources for troubleshooting and best practices.
6. Conduct Product Demonstrations and Proof-of-Concept Testing
After evaluating the software’s capabilities and features on paper, it’s crucial to see the software in action. Request product demonstrations from the vendors to observe how the software functions in real-world scenarios. During these demonstrations, pay close attention to how the software handles your specific use cases and requirements.
Additionally, consider conducting proof-of-concept (PoC) testing or pilot projects to validate the software’s performance in your organization’s environment. This hands-on testing will provide valuable insights into the software’s integration capabilities, performance, and usability within your existing infrastructure and workflows.
7. Gather Feedback and Stakeholder Buy-In
Throughout the evaluation process, it’s essential to gather feedback from key stakeholders and end-users. Their input can help identify potential issues, uncover additional requirements, and ensure the software meets the needs of different departments and roles within your organization.
Conduct focus group sessions or distribute surveys to collect feedback on the software’s features, user experience, and alignment with business processes. This feedback can be invaluable in making an informed decision and gaining buy-in from stakeholders across the organization.
